How they compare
Iceland currently reports 0.999 GPIA against 0.9928 GPIA in MDG: Southern Asia (excluding India), a difference of 0.0062 GPIA.
Across all 26 years both countries report, Iceland has been ahead every year.
Iceland ranks 91st and MDG: Southern Asia (excluding India) ranks 93rd of 199 countries.
Iceland has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Iceland | MDG: Southern Asia (excluding India) |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.9889 GPIA | 0.842 GPIA | 0.1469 GPIA | Iceland |
| 2000s | 0.9905 GPIA | 0.8871 GPIA | 0.1034 GPIA | Iceland |
| 2010s | 0.999 GPIA | 0.9466 GPIA | 0.0524 GPIA | Iceland |
| 2020s | 0.9986 GPIA | 0.9637 GPIA | 0.0349 GPIA | Iceland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
